Gamma

Generate presentations, docs, and sites from a prompt

Gamma creates presentations, documents, and simple web pages from a text prompt or outline. Generated decks are editable in a card-based interface and can be published as links or exported.

Wegic

Build and publish a website by chatting with an AI

Wegic is an AI website builder that creates and edits a site through a chat conversation. You describe the site type, name, and style, the AI generates the pages, and you publish in one click. It positions itself as an AI website team (designer, developer, and manager) so non-technical users can launch a site without code.
